5 Things To Consider When Buying Beauty Products

Beauty routines have become integral to many individuals' lives, providing benefits when performed correctly and regularly. With an overwhelming range of options available on the market, choosing the right products can be daunting. According to recent search results, understanding beauty products involves considering various factors, from ingredients and customer reviews to your unique skin or hair type. With the beauty industry generating an impressive $528.59 billion in revenue last year, selecting suitable items is crucial for maintaining healthy skin and hair. Here are five important points to keep in mind before purchasing your next beauty product.

1. Check Ingredients and Formula

How often do you evaluate the ingredients and formulations of your beauty products? While it may be convenient to choose items from your favorite brand, doing so without careful consideration can lead to adverse effects. To find beauty products that suit your skin or hair, scrutinize their components. Always read the product labels and avoid harsh additives like sulfates, parabens, and synthetic fragrances. Alcohol is another ingredient to be cautious of, as it can irritate and damage skin and hair over time. Look for products enriched with natural extracts, essential oils, and vitamins for a healthier look. Some beneficial ingredients include hyaluronic acid for hydration, niacinamide for brightening, and antioxidants for protection. For hair care, consider argan oil, keratin, and shea butter to maintain shiny locks.

2. Customer Reviews and Ratings

While some manufacturers create positive reviews for their products, many genuine ones offer valuable insights into a product's effectiveness. Honest reviews showcase real experiences, but it's essential to note that results may vary based on individual skin or hair types. For instance, a person with sensitive skin may provide glowing reviews for a product that minimizes irritation. To decipher the reviews, look for recurring themes and keywords that indicate a balanced understanding of the products. Words like gentle, hydrating, nourishing, smooth, and long-lasting can signal positive attributes of a product.

3. Consider Budget and Value

It can be tempting to splurge on luxury beauty products, but considering your budget and the value each item offers is vital. Some high-end items deliver outstanding results, but there are also affordable alternatives that can provide similar benefits. If you want to save, explore value sets or multi-use products, which can be more economical in the long run. Remember that a higher price doesn't always guarantee better results. Find a balance between your budget and the quality of the products to create an effective beauty routine. Avoid overspending if your monthly budget doesn't accommodate high-end purchases. Online searches can help identify products within your budget that deliver value.

4. Know Your Skin or Hair Type and Concerns

Take the time to identify your skin or hair type before embarking on a shopping spree. Knowing whether your skin is dry, oily, combination, or sensitive will guide you in choosing the right skincare items. If you face issues like acne, hyperpigmentation, fine lines, or frizz, seek products containing ingredients that target these specific concerns. Aligning your product choices with your unique attributes will yield more effective results. Similarly, understanding your hair type, whether straight, wavy, curly, or coily, is essential for selecting the most suitable hair care products. Your natural hair color should also guide you in choosing appropriate highlighting items, ensuring you select products that suit your individual needs.

5. Look for Sample Sizes or Trial Offers

If you're hesitant about investing in a full-sized product, consider seeking out sample sizes or trial offers. Many beauty brands provide sample packs or travel-sized versions of their products, allowing you to test them before committing. This is particularly advantageous in the skincare and haircare sectors, where brands aim to convert potential customers into loyal ones. Utilize these options to experiment with various brands and products until you discover the ones that resonate with you. While trying out samples, performing a patch test is crucial to identify any potential irritations or allergies. Consulting your dermatologist is advisable if you encounter any issues. Note that certain brands require patch tests as part of their usage guidelines, and failing to follow these instructions may nullify your rights for claims.

In summary, weighing these considerations when purchasing beauty products is essential to make informed choices that align with your needs.
